For the FBCN centrifugal in Jataúba, correct selection comes from the circuit's flow × head pair: the right model is the one that places the operating point near BEP (best efficiency point), where efficiency and reliability go together. A pump oversized "to be safe" runs in internal recirculation — vibration, radial load and short seal life.

FB Bombas application engineering supports ISO 10816 vibration analysis (velocity RMS in mm/s) for diagnosing misalignment, imbalance, bearing defects and cavitation on pumps installed in Jataúba. The service includes baseline capture at startup, spectral comparison during PM campaigns, and intervention recommendations (re-balancing, bearing replacement, laser alignment) before vibration exceeds the standard’s zone D.

For each delivery to Jataúba, FB Bombas assembles the unit's complete technical Data Book, containing: hydraulic test certificate, material certificates — stainless steel, duplex or ductile cast iron, per spec —, ISO 21940 G2.5 balancing report, characteristic curve obtained on the bench, API 682 mechanical-seal data sheets, operation and maintenance manual and as-built drawings. Full traceability happens through the serial number.

The FBCN series complies with ASME B73.1 (North American standard for horizontal end-suction process centrifugal pumps) — which enables retrofit on existing baseplates in Jataúba plants, whoever manufactured the installed unit, provided the dimension designation matches. Shaft dimensions, suction/discharge flanges, casing feet and impeller centerline follow the standard: the complete FBCN pump goes in and piping and baseplate stay put.
